Bluetooth adapter error 43 on alienware 17 R3

Hello everyone, this is my first post here so sorry if I ramble! I recently bought a used alienware 17 R3 which came with windows 10. I'm not a fan of win 10 so I installed win 8.1 instead, all the drivers went on fine but the Bluetooth adapter is showing error 43 its been stopped by windows. I have looked for answers, but found none that work. I have tried uninstalling and reinstalling the driver but no luck. I would go to the manufacturers site and download their driver but in device manager the adapter just says "generic Bluetooth adapter". I can't seem to find a Bluetooth driver on the dell site either. Out of ideas on this and need some help please folks.
